The final project selected to take part in the first Latin American Co-Production Market in Panama City from April 7-9 has been announced (26) during the the 29th Guadalajara International Film Festival.

The project is Las Tinieblas directed by Daniel Castro Zimbrón from Mexico.

As previously mentioned, organisers of the MEETS Film Market will award a $25,000 cash prize on the winner.

The Latin American Co-Production Market will run during the third International Film Festival Of Panama.

The 11 previously announced MEETS projects are Dr. Fe (Colombia), Blood Window (Colombia), The Bolivian Case (Bolivia), El Marco De La Cara (Dominican Republic),

Érase Una Vez En El Caribe (Puerto Rico), Mi Mundial (Uruguay-Brazil) and the five Panamanian projects, Buscando Al Indio Conejo, Gauguin Y El Canal, Kimura, Piedra Roja and Soñar Con La Ciudad.
